概念 Bean创建过程中的“实例化”与“初始化”名词 实例化(Instantiation): 要生成对象, 对象还未生成. 初始化(Initialization): 对象已经生成.,赋值操作。 BeanPostProcessor : 发生 ...
概念 Bean创建过程中的 实例化 与 初始化 名词 实例化 Instantiation : 要生成对象, 对象还未生成. 初始化 Initialization : 对象已经生成.,赋值操作。 BeanPostProcessor : 发生在 BeanDefiniton 加工Bean 阶段. 具有拦截器的含义. 可以拦截BeanDefinition创建Bean的过程, 然后插入拦截方法,做扩展工作. ...
2019-10-23 09:16 0 648 推荐指数:
概念 Bean创建过程中的“实例化”与“初始化”名词 实例化(Instantiation): 要生成对象, 对象还未生成. 初始化(Initialization): 对象已经生成.,赋值操作。 BeanPostProcessor : 发生 ...
在上篇博客中写道了bean后置处理器InstantiationAwareBeanPostProcessor,只介绍了其中一个方法的作用及用法,现在来看postProcessBeforeInstantiation方法。 一、概述 postProcessBeforeInstantiation方法 ...
场景等。在InstantiationAwareBeanPostProcessor中还有两个方法,分别是postProcessProperties和postProcess ...
更多文章点击--spring源码分析系列 主要分析内容: 一、InstantiationAwareBeanPostProcessor简述与demo示例 二、InstantiationAwareBeanPostProcessor与BeanPostProcessor对比 ...
1.官方解答: Factory hook that allows for custom modification of new bean instances, e.g. checking for m ...
Spring提供了两种后处理bean的扩展接口,分别为BeanPostProcessor和BeanFactoryPostProcessor,这两者在使用上是有所区别的。 BeanPostProcessor:bean级别的处理,针对某个具体的bean进行处理 接口提供了两个方法,分别是初始化 ...
一、何谓BeanProcessor BeanPostProcessor是SpringFramework里非常重要的核心接口之一,我先贴出一段源代码: View Code 在这里我先简单解释一下其注释的含义: 这个接口允许我们自定义修改新 ...